What's in it.

Every Thursday, a deeper read on what's moving in SD tech.

The dual-use companies building at the intersection of defense and commercial markets. What's coming out of UCSD and SDSU before it hits the news. Raises, hires, and exits worth paying attention to. An insider story the local press hasn't written yet. Events worth showing up to, with codes when we have them.

San Diego has battery companies, drone manufacturers, biotech that can't be built anywhere else, and UCSD spinouts going from lab to NASA contract in six months. Most of it stays quiet. Military contracts don't come with press releases. The Howlpha is the read for people who want to know before the room figures it out.
